Features

Robot vacuums are amazing machines. If they are programmed with the right settings, they will navigate your home, staying clear of cords and furniture to scrub every inch of your floor. How do these robots know where they are and what they should do? As an ant in its colony, a robot depends on a variety of sensors to comprehend the world around it.

Most robot vacuums are equipped with sensors that face downwards to help them avoid obstacles. The best models could also have forward-facing sensors which enable them to map rooms and locate furniture to provide cleaner and more precise cleaning.

The newest models even come with advanced features like dirt sense (which evaluates the amount of dirt in the water and prompts it to remop, if necessary) and "freo" mopping technology (which automatically adjusts the pressure depending on the flooring materials, putting on more force to tiles and less force for hardwood, for instance).

To ensure safety, many robot vacuums are also equipped with sensors for cliffs that stop them from falling off stairs. These sensors determine the distance between the bottom of the robot and any objects by bouncing an infra red light off of them. If the sensor detects an abrupt decrease in distance, it will be aware that it is getting closer to a stepping stone and will move away.

In addition to navigating your home, a lot of robots can also sweep and mop your floors in one pass. It is possible to manually soak your mop before attaching the bot to it, or the bot will have an integrated water tank that can be activated by pressing a button.

Depending on the type of robot you pick You can control it via an app on your phone or voice command using Google Assistant. The more advanced models come with scheduling apps that can keep the track of your cleaning schedule and automatically begin and stop at times that match your lifestyle. Certain models come with virtual walls which let you create a boundary for the robot around areas you want to keep clear of. This is particularly useful for pet owners or children who are notorious for causing mess.

The majority of robot vacuum cleaners today employ sensors in conjunction with motor controls that are embedded to move around your home. Sensors are used to detect walls and obstacles and motor controllers ensure that the wheels are moving in the correct direction to avoid hitting furniture or other objects. Certain models employ 360 LiDAR to map the space and navigate around the home. These systems reduce time and effort by permitting the robot to continue cleaning even when it encounters obstacles.

The use of optical sensors is to determine the type of surface on floors and other surfaces. They do this by bouncing infra-red lights off of the floor and then determining the average magnitude of the return signal to determine the type of surface. The robot can then adjust its speed and other features, depending on whether it's moving on hardwood or carpet. Other sensors, for instance the cliff sensors, could be used to prevent the robot vacuum bagless self-emptying from falling off stairs.

Maintenance

Robot vacuums are a fantastic method to keep your home tidy however, they require regular maintenance for optimal performance. Clogged brushes, filters and sensors can decrease the suction power of a robot and cause it to malfunction. If they are not properly cleaned these components could lead to costly repairs or replacements. The good news is that a few easy steps can keep your robotic vacuum in top condition for many years to come.

The first step to maintain a robot vacuum bagless is to regularly empty the bin. This is particularly important if you have pets in your home. You should also remove the brush and rinse it thoroughly after every cleaning cycle. If you have a high-end robot vacuum, it could have a feature that automatically emptys its dust bin.

The next step is to clean the sensors on your robot vacuum. These are vital for the safety of the machine and navigation features. To prevent them from getting dirty, wipe them with a microfiber cloth. Make sure you use a dry cloth since water can damage the sensors' covering. If you're not sure the location of the sensors on your robot, consult the manual of the manufacturer to find specific instructions.

Lastly, you should check for firmware updates and install them whenever they are available. These updates will improve the robot's navigation, performance and battery life. You can download these updates for free through the app store on your device.
